深度探索:DeepSeek大模型的技术突破与应用实践
2025.09.12 11:09浏览量:0简介:本文深入解析DeepSeek大模型的核心架构、技术优势及行业应用场景,通过多维度对比与代码示例展示其开发价值,为开发者提供技术选型与优化实践指南。
一、DeepSeek大模型的技术定位与核心优势
DeepSeek大模型作为新一代人工智能基础架构,其设计目标聚焦于高效计算、精准推理与泛化能力的平衡。与传统大模型相比,DeepSeek通过动态稀疏注意力机制(Dynamic Sparse Attention)将计算复杂度从O(n²)降至O(n log n),在保持长文本处理能力的同时,显著降低显存占用。例如,在处理10万token的文本时,DeepSeek-V3的显存消耗较传统模型减少58%,推理速度提升2.3倍。
技术架构上,DeepSeek采用混合专家模型(MoE)设计,包含128个专家模块,每个token仅激活4个专家,实现参数效率的指数级提升。其训练数据集涵盖多语言文本、代码库、科学文献及结构化知识图谱,总规模达12万亿token,其中30%为非英语数据,支持中英日韩等28种语言的零样本迁移。
二、关键技术突破解析
1. 动态注意力优化
DeepSeek的注意力机制通过局部敏感哈希(LSH)实现动态计算路径选择。例如,在代码生成任务中,模型可自动识别代码结构中的关键依赖关系,优先计算函数调用链相关的注意力权重,避免无效计算。代码示例如下:
# DeepSeek动态注意力示例
class DynamicAttention(nn.Module):
def __init__(self, dim, heads=8):
super().__init__()
self.heads = heads
self.scale = (dim // heads) ** -0.5
self.to_qkv = nn.Linear(dim, dim * 3)
def forward(self, x, mask=None):
q, k, v = self.to_qkv(x).chunk(3, dim=-1)
# 动态哈希分组
hash_buckets = self.lsh_project(q) # 输出[batch, seq_len, heads]
# 分组计算注意力
attn_output = []
for bucket in range(self.heads):
mask_bucket = (hash_buckets == bucket)
attn = self.scaled_dot_product(q[:,:,bucket], k[:,:,bucket], v[:,:,bucket], mask_bucket)
attn_output.append(attn)
return torch.cat(attn_output, dim=-1)
2. 强化学习驱动的参数优化
DeepSeek引入近端策略优化(PPO)算法进行模型微调,通过奖励模型(Reward Model)直接优化生成结果的质量。在数学推理任务中,该技术使模型解答正确率从72%提升至89%,显著优于传统监督微调方法。
3. 多模态统一表示
通过跨模态注意力桥接(Cross-Modal Attention Bridge),DeepSeek实现文本、图像、音频的统一语义空间建模。在视觉问答任务中,模型可同时处理图像特征与文本问题,生成结构化回答,准确率较单模态模型提升41%。
三、行业应用场景与案例
1. 金融风控领域
某头部银行采用DeepSeek构建反欺诈系统,通过分析用户行为序列与交易文本,实现98.7%的欺诈交易识别准确率。模型输入示例:
{
"user_id": "U12345",
"transaction_seq": [
{"amount": 500, "time": "2023-01-01T09:30:00", "merchant": "电商A"},
{"amount": 12000, "time": "2023-01-01T10:15:00", "merchant": "珠宝B"}
],
"text_log": "用户急切要求加急处理订单"
}
模型输出风险评分与解释报告,辅助人工复核效率提升60%。
2. 医疗诊断辅助
在放射科影像分析中,DeepSeek通过多模态输入(DICOM影像+电子病历文本)生成诊断建议。实验表明,其对肺结节良恶性的判断与资深医生一致性达94%,且可自动生成鉴别诊断要点。
3. 代码开发优化
针对软件开发场景,DeepSeek提供上下文感知的代码补全功能。在GitHub开源项目分析中,模型可准确预测函数参数类型与异常处理逻辑,开发者采纳建议后代码缺陷率降低37%。
四、开发者实践指南
1. 模型部署优化
- 量化压缩:使用INT8量化技术可将模型体积缩小4倍,推理速度提升2.8倍,精度损失<1%
- 分布式推理:通过Tensor Parallelism实现跨GPU的注意力计算分割,支持千亿参数模型的单机多卡部署
- 服务化架构:推荐使用Triton Inference Server构建REST API,示例配置如下:
# Triton模型仓库配置
name: "deepseek_v3"
platform: "pytorch_libtorch"
max_batch_size: 32
input [
{
name: "INPUT__0"
data_type: "FP32"
dims: [ -1, -1, 1024 ]
}
]
2. 微调策略建议
- 领域适应:在法律文书生成任务中,采用LoRA技术仅微调0.1%的参数,即可达到专业律师水平
- 数据工程:建议按7
1比例构建训练集、验证集、测试集,并使用CLUE评分体系评估模型性能
- 超参调优:初始学习率设置为1e-5,batch size根据显存容量选择256-1024,采用余弦退火调度器
五、技术挑战与未来方向
当前DeepSeek面临长文本推理的因果关系建模与多轮对话的状态追踪两大挑战。研究团队正探索基于神经符号系统的混合架构,通过引入逻辑规则约束提升模型的可解释性。预计2024年Q3发布的V4版本将支持实时语音交互与3D场景理解,进一步拓展应用边界。
对于开发者而言,掌握DeepSeek的动态计算优化技术与多模态融合方法,将成为构建下一代AI应用的核心竞争力。建议从代码生成、数据分析等垂直场景切入,逐步积累模型调优经验。
发表评论
登录后可评论,请前往 登录 或 注册